Sunrooms

A sunroom is a beautiful, functional addition to your home, providing a connection to nature while offering protection from the elements. To keep it in optimal condition, regular maintenance is essential.

  • Cleaning: Wipe down the glass panes and frame with a gentle glass cleaner and soft cloth. Inspect the seals for leaks and damage, especially after heavy rain or snow.
  • Maintenance Tips: Check for signs of warping, cracked seals, or condensation buildup. Ensure all components, like the screens, are in good condition, replacing any damaged parts.
  • Seasonal Care: In colder months, inspect for drafts and ensure proper insulation. In warmer months, ventilate the sunroom to prevent overheating and condensation.

Screen Room Windows & Doors

Screen rooms provide a great outdoor experience with the protection of mesh screens. Maintaining their functionality requires attention to the details.

  • Cleaning: Remove screens periodically for thorough cleaning. Rinse with water and a soft brush to remove debris, and let them air dry.
  • Maintenance Tips: Check for tears or dents in the screens and replace as necessary. Inspect the frames and seals around windows and doors to prevent potential leaks.
  • Seasonal Care: Ensure proper fit and seal before winter to avoid cold drafts. Keep the screens clean and debris-free during the spring and summer.

Patio Covers

Patio covers protect your outdoor living space from sun and rain, but they too need regular care.

  • Cleaning: Wipe down the cover with mild soap and water to remove dirt and stains. Use a soft brush to clean harder-to-reach areas.
  • Maintenance Tips: Inspect the framework for signs of rust or damage. Ensure the cover is securely fastened, especially before the winter months when wind and snow loads may increase.
  • Seasonal Care: In winter, remove snow accumulation from the cover to avoid excess weight. Check for any warping or loosening in spring after severe weather.

Porch Enclosures

Porch enclosures offer an extended living space, and regular upkeep will maintain their longevity and comfort.

  • Cleaning: Use non-abrasive cleaners to wipe down the glass, walls, and frames. Clean the screens regularly to maintain airflow.
  • Maintenance Tips: Inspect for leaks or water damage after heavy rain. Tighten any loose screws or fittings in the frame.
  • Seasonal Care: Check insulation before winter, ensuring doors and windows seal tightly. During summer, maintain airflow by cleaning the screens and ensuring proper ventilation.

Bi-Fold Doors

Bi-fold doors provide a seamless transition between indoor and outdoor spaces. Proper care ensures their smooth operation and long-lasting appearance.

  • Cleaning: Clean the glass panels and door tracks with a soft cloth and glass cleaner. Keep the tracks free from debris to ensure smooth operation.
  • Maintenance Tips: Lubricate the hinges and check for any misalignments in the doors. Inspect the seals and gaskets to prevent drafts.
  • Seasonal Care: Ensure the tracks are clear of snow and ice in the winter to avoid damage. Check for proper door alignment after extreme temperature changes.

Deck/Railing Systems

Decks and railings are essential for outdoor safety and aesthetics. Regular care helps maintain their integrity and appearance.

  • Cleaning: Use a mild cleaner and soft brush to scrub the deck boards and railing. Rinse thoroughly with water to remove soap residue.
  • Maintenance Tips: Check for any loose boards or railings and tighten as needed. Inspect for cracks or signs of wear and tear.
  • Seasonal Care: Reapply a protective finish or stain to the deck before winter to protect against moisture. In spring, check for any damage caused by snow or ice.
